Payment Types Accepted: checks, cashiers/bank check, money order Description: WONDERFUL HOLLYWOOD MOVIE GUN! 1892 .44-40 20" FACTORY SHORT RIFLE, "S" MARKED (STEMBRIDGE GUN RENTALS, HOLLYWOOD, CALIFORNIA), #822XXX, MADE 1917. Stembridge supplied all the guns for the old Westerns from about 1916 onward. If you look carefully at the old TV and movies you'll see these 20" short rifles. Usually they took a terrible beating, as when they are thrown down from stage coaches (ouch!) or dropped from horseback etc. Stembridge used real factory short rifles with correct Winchester short forends etc., NOT cut down rifles. So, this makes them great Winchester 1892 collectibles plus Hollywood collectibles! This example is one of the better ones I've seen. The wood is surprisingly excellent with tight wood to metal fit. The receiver shows good aged blue with the usual edge wear. Barrel and mag are a soft brown with good markings and Buckhorn rear sight with elevator bar intact and small blade/bead front sight- probably had some cold blue added at some time in the past that has aged. There are two holes with filler screws in the left upper rear of the receiver for a Lyman receiver sight. The action is tight with good half-cock safety and the bore is surprisingly fine with good rifling and only some scattered light pitting- unusuall as these rifles were typically fired with black powder 5-in-one blanks that were rough on bores if not cleaned immediately. Has the typical "S" stamp below the serial number and in the wood behind the lower tang. One can't help wondering what movie stars and personalities worked with this '92 20" oct. short rifle!
